Sixty-nine percent of U.S heads of household play video or computer games. Choose 4 heads of household at random. Find the probability that none play video or computer games.

Answers

Answer: 0.00923521

Step-by-step explanation:

Given : The probability U.S households play video or computer games=69%=0.69

here, the probability of each U.S household play video or computer games is fixed as 0.69

Then, the probability of each U.S household not play video or computer games= 1-0.69=0.31

For independent events the probability of their intersection is product of probability of each event.

Now, the probability that none play video/computer games will be :-

\((0.31)^4=0.00923521\)

Answer:

In philosophy  and psychology, a nativist is a person who believes in an innate understanding of particular concepts. This includes innate knowledge and ideas which occur at birth and are not acquired through learning and experience.

In United States history, a nativist is a person who opposes immigration of any kind which is deemed "undesirable" and who advocates for the exclusive interests of native-born citizens, often from longtime American families. Nativists disliked Catholics as well as immigrants and minorities.

A famous nativist organisation of America is the Know-Nothing party of the 1840s.
